Year of the Sea Lecture Series now available online
Following the success of the 'Year of the Sea' marine science lectures (sponsored by the Sêr Cymru National Research Network for Low Carbon, Energy and Environment), we are pleased to announce that the lectures are all now available online.
Presented by leading marine scientists, all internationally recognised experts in their respective fields, the lectures examined the diversity of life in our oceans and showed how research is addressing areas of current concern.
